The Official Top Speed

This motorcycle has an official top speed of approximately 190 km/h (118 mph) under optimal conditions. This maximum speed makes it one of the fastest motorcycles in the entry-level sport bike segment. Powered by a:

  • 🏍️ Engine: 399cc parallel-twin engine
  • ⚡ Horsepower: 45-49 HP @ 10,000 RPM for thrilling acceleration
  • đź’Ą Torque: 38 Nm @ 8,000 RPM for strong mid-range pull

It typically accelerates from 0 to 100 km/h (0 to 62 mph) in approximately 4.6 to 5.0 seconds under ideal conditions. For the 0 to 100 mph (0 to 161 km/h) time, which is less commonly cited, the Ninja 400 takes roughly 15-16 seconds.

That Ninja motorcycle delivers impressive straight-line performance despite its modest displacement.

Power Delivery and RPM Performance

At lower RPMs (2,000-4,000), the Ninja 400 provides smooth, manageable power—perfect for navigating city streets. The mid-range (5,000-8,000 RPM) is where the bike really comes alive, offering punchy acceleration for highway passing and spirited riding. Above 8,000 RPM, the engine eagerly revs to redline, giving experienced riders that sport bike rush without the intimidation factor of a 600cc+ supersport.

Fuel Efficiency and Capacity

One of the Ninja 400’s greatest strengths is its fuel efficiency. Riders can expect approximately 55-65 mpg in city conditions and upwards of 65-70 mpg on highway rides. With its 3.7-gallon fuel tank, that translates to a theoretical range of 200-250 miles between fill-ups.

The Ninja 400 runs best on regular 87 octane fuel, saving you money at the pump compared to premium-requiring alternatives.

Cooling System and Engine Longevity

The Ninja 400 features a liquid-cooling system that helps maintain optimal operating temperatures even in hot weather or stop-and-go traffic. This cooling efficiency contributes to the impressive expected engine lifespan.

With proper maintenance, many owners report their Ninja 400 engines easily surpassing 50,000 miles without major issues. Some have even pushed beyond 80,000 miles while maintaining good performance. The key is following the recommended maintenance schedule and not abusing the engine with constant redlining or improper break-in.

Physical Dimensions and Ergonomics

The Ninja 400 has a wet weight of 366 pounds (with ABS), making it one of the lighter sport bikes on the market. This translates to easy handling for riders of all experience levels.

The seat height is 30.9 inches, which accommodates most riders without feeling too cramped or stretched. The overall dimensions are approximately 78.3 inches in length, 28.3 inches in width, and 45.7 inches in height.

Ground clearance sits at 5.5 inches, providing sufficient room for normal riding conditions while maintaining a sporty profile.

ABS vs Non-ABS

The primary difference between ABS and non-ABS models is the anti-lock braking system, which prevents wheel lock-up during hard braking. The ABS model typically costs $400 more than the non-ABS version.

The ABS system adds about 4-5 pounds to the bike’s weight—a negligible difference for most riders. There are no other performance differences between the models.

For safety reasons, the ABS option is highly recommended, especially for newer riders or those who frequently ride in varying weather conditions.

Factors That Impact Your Top Speed

While 118 mph looks impressive on paper, several factors determine whether you’ll actually reach this speed on your Ninja 400:

1. Rider Weight and Position

Physics doesn’t lie: a lighter rider will typically achieve higher top speeds than a heavier one. Additionally, your riding position dramatically affects aerodynamics:

  • Tucked position: Reduces drag significantly, potentially adding 5-10 mph to your top speed
  • Upright position: Creates more wind resistance, reducing potential top speed

A 150-pound rider in a full racing tuck will likely achieve higher speeds than a 220-pound rider sitting upright.

2. Environmental Conditions

The environment plays a crucial role in determining your actual top speed:

  • Headwinds: Can reduce top speed by 5-15 mph depending on intensity
  • Tailwinds: May add a few mph to your top speed
  • Altitude: Higher elevations mean thinner air and less oxygen for combustion, reducing power
  • Temperature: Cooler, denser air typically improves engine performance

3. Road Conditions

The surface you’re riding on matters tremendously:

  • Smooth, flat surfaces: Ideal for achieving maximum speed
  • Uphill sections: Will reduce your top speed significantly
  • Rough pavement: Forces riders to slow down for safety

4. Mechanical Condition

Your Ninja 400’s maintenance status directly impacts its performance:

  • Chain tension: Improper adjustment can rob power
  • Tire pressure: Underinflated tires increase rolling resistance
  • Air filter: A clogged filter restricts airflow to the engine
  • Engine oil: Old or incorrect oil can increase internal friction

Stock vs Modified

The stock Kawasaki Ninja 400 comes with electronic limitations from the factory, capping the top speed at around 118 mph. However, many riders choose to modify their bikes to extract more performance and increase the Kawasaki Ninja 400 maximum speed:

Common Modifications and Their Impact

  1. ECU Flash/Power Commander: Removes electronic limitations and optimizes fuel mapping
    • Potential gain: 3-7 mph in top speed
  2. Aftermarket Exhaust System: Reduces back pressure and weight
    • Potential gain: 2-5 mph when combined with ECU tuning
  3. Sprocket Changes: Altering gearing for higher top-end speed
    • Potential gain: 5-10 mph (at the expense of acceleration)
  4. Aerodynamic Improvements: Racing windscreens, fairings
    • Potential gain: 2-4 mph through reduced drag

Some riders report achieving speeds of 200 km/h (124 mph) or slightly more with a combination of these modifications. However, these modifications typically come at the cost of warranty coverage, reliability, and fuel efficiency.

Is the Kawasaki Ninja 400 Top Speed Enough for Most Riders?

For street riding, the Kawasaki Ninja 400’s maximum speed of 118 mph is more than sufficient, considering:

  • The highest speed limit in the United States is 85 mph (Texas State Highway 130)
  • Most countries have speed limits well below 100 mph
  • The bike reaches highway speeds (60-80 mph) with plenty of power to spare
